People watching...

Lucas and I went to the library tonight. We were in line to check out our books and a guy walked past with a small backpack on. Lucas said, "Hey!! An astronaut!!" Honestly, I couldn't figure out who he was talking about so I just started looking around for a guy in a silver suit and an oxygen tank. The backpack dude turned around and said in a rather monotone voice, "Uh, I think he's talking about me..."

I was just slightly embarassed. People in line behind me were cracking up. Now the story doesn't end here. The guy proceeds to walk up to Lucas and in a creepy way says, "Hey buddy, do you want to be an astronaut when you grow up?" Lucas just stared. Then the guy reaches in his pocket and pulls out a handful of change and gives it to Lucas. Weird. And the lady behind me must have thought so too because she made a strange noise that to me, meant... creep...ee.

I'm sure he is a very nice guy... I just found myself very defensive with Lucas by my side.
